Description
SORAFENIB N-OXIDE is a metabolite of Sorafenib, a potent Raf kinase inhibitor. It is characterized by its pale yellow solid appearance. SORAFENIB N-OXIDE is known for its potential applications in various fields due to its chemical properties and biological activities.

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 583840-03-3 includes 9 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 6 digits, 5,8,3,8,4 and 0 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 0 and 3 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 583840-03:
(8*5)+(7*8)+(6*3)+(5*8)+(4*4)+(3*0)+(2*0)+(1*3)=173
173 % 10 = 3
So 583840-03-3 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
